服务器设置和教程 · 6 10 月, 2024

CentOS 7.3 下利用 Cobbler 2.8.0 安裝部署 ESXi 5.5

CentOS 7.3 下利用 Cobbler 2.8.0 安裝部署 ESXi 5.5

在虛擬化技術日益普及的今天,ESXi 作為 VMware 的一款虛擬化平台,廣泛應用於數據中心和企業環境中。為了提高部署效率,Cobbler 作為一個強大的系統安裝和管理工具,能夠幫助用戶快速安裝和配置 ESXi。本文將介紹如何在 CentOS 7.3 環境下利用 Cobbler 2.8.0 安裝部署 ESXi 5.5。

環境準備

在開始之前,您需要準備以下環境:

  • 一台運行 CentOS 7.3 的伺服器。
  • 安裝 Cobbler 2.8.0。
  • ESXi 5.5 的安裝映像文件。
  • 網絡連接,確保伺服器能夠訪問外部網絡。

安裝 Cobbler

首先,您需要在 CentOS 7.3 上安裝 Cobbler。可以通過以下命令進行安裝:

sudo yum install cobbler cobbler-web

安裝完成後,啟動 Cobbler 服務並設置開機自啟:

sudo systemctl start cobblerd
sudo systemctl enable cobblerd

配置 Cobbler

接下來,您需要配置 Cobbler。首先,編輯 Cobbler 的主配置文件:

sudo vi /etc/cobbler/settings

在文件中,您需要設置以下幾個參數:

  • next_server: 設置為 Cobbler 伺服器的 IP 地址。
  • server: 設置為 Cobbler 伺服器的主機名或 IP 地址。

完成後,保存並退出編輯器。接下來,您需要同步 Cobbler 的配置:

sudo cobbler sync

上傳 ESXi 5.5 映像

將 ESXi 5.5 的安裝映像上傳到 Cobbler。首先,創建一個目錄來存放映像:

sudo mkdir /var/www/cobbler/ks_mirror/esxi

然後,將 ESXi 映像文件複製到該目錄中。接下來,您需要在 Cobbler 中添加這個映像:

sudo cobbler import --path=/var/www/cobbler/ks_mirror/esxi/ESXi-5.5.iso --name=esxi55

創建啟動配置

現在,您需要創建一個啟動配置,以便能夠通過網絡啟動 ESXi。使用以下命令創建一個新的系統配置:

sudo cobbler system add --name=esxi55 --profile=esxi55 --mac=00:11:22:33:44:55 --ip-address=192.168.1.100 --netmask=255.255.255.0 --gateway=192.168.1.1

在這裡,您需要根據實際情況替換 MAC 地址、IP 地址、子網掩碼和網關。

啟動和安裝 ESXi

完成上述步驟後,您可以通過 PXE 網絡啟動來安裝 ESXi。確保您的客戶端機器設置為從網絡啟動,然後重啟機器。它將自動從 Cobbler 伺服器獲取啟動映像並開始安裝 ESXi 5.5。

總結

通過以上步驟,您可以在 CentOS 7.3 環境下利用 Cobbler 2.8.0 成功安裝和部署 ESXi 5.5。這種方法不僅提高了安裝效率,還能夠方便地管理多台虛擬機器。若您需要進一步的伺服器解決方案,請參考我們的 香港伺服器 服務,獲取更多資訊。